Peak Reliability; Request for Clarification of Peak Reliability
Take notice that on May 12, 2016 Peak Reliability (Peak) requested clarification that, consistent with Order No. 787,1 interstate natural gas pipelines may share non-public, operational information with Peak in connection with its performance of its Reliability Coordinator duties, subject to any appropriate non-disclosure agreements.
